Evian-les-Bains, May 26 -- Avani Prashanth finished as the highest placed Indian player at the Jabra Ladies Open. A final round card of two-under 69 helped her to tie 28.
India's other players were Hitaashee Bakshi and Tvesa Malik at T-34 and Diksha Dagar at T-39.
Czech player Sara Kouskova played a strong final round of four under par to secure her first LET title by two shots over her closest competitor, Shannon Tan. Kouskova carded 67 for a 10-under total and two better than Shannon (68) at 8-under.
Avani has had a strong season and has failed to make the cut only twice this year in eight starts. Avani, a winner on her Pro Golf Tour while being an amateur, has had three Top-20 finishes in her rookie year.
